WebThe crystal structure of the solid electrolyte RbAg 4 I 5 has been determined from single-crystal x-ray diffraction counter data. There are four RbAg 4 I 5 in a cubic unit cell with a = 11.24 Å. The structure refinement, by least squares, is based on space group P 4 1 3 ( O7 ). The arrangement of the iodide ions is similar to that of the ...

WebSep 30, 2024 · Crystal, also known as crystalline solid, is a solid material that consists of atoms, molecules, or ions, that are orderly arranged. The lattice formed in crystals extends out in three (3) dimensions. Crystals have recognizable structures due to the repeated units formed. Crystal structures may be conveniently specified by describing the arrangement within the solid of a small representative group of atoms or molecules, called the ‘unit cell.’ By multiplying identical unit cells in three directions, the location of all the particles in the crystal is determined.
WebDec 18, 2015 · 2. Around 90 per cent of all drugs are actually crystals. That’s because it’s much easier to control the solid state of a crystalline structure - even if you’re using a gel, that would involve crystals that are suspended in a gooey substance to aid the delivery of the drug involved.
